What is Meal Planning?
Meal planning is the process of deciding in advance what you will eat for each meal and snack. It involves planning ahead by making a list of ingredients and preparing meals ahead of time, whether that means making a week’s worth of meals in one shot, or simply preparing the ingredients for the week so that meals can be quickly and easily thrown together.
The Benefits of Meal Planning
Meal planning provides several benefits that contribute to sustainable weight loss. These benefits include:
1. Portion control – by planning your meals, you can control your portions and ensure that you are eating the right amount of food to support your weight loss goals.
2. Saves time and money – by planning your meals ahead of time, you can save money on groceries because you know exactly what you need to buy. It also saves time during busy weeks because you won’t need to spend time figuring out what to eat or running to the grocery store for ingredients.
3. Reduces stress – planning your meals and having them ready saves you the stress of trying to figure out what to eat on the spot. This also makes it easier to avoid unhealthy choices, like takeout or fast food, which can sabotage your weight loss goals.
4. Encourages variety – by planning your meals, you will naturally introduce more variety into your diet. This variety can help keep you motivated and interested in cooking and eating healthy foods.
How to Meal Plan for Sustainable Weight Loss
Meal planning for sustainable weight loss doesn’t need to be complicated. Start by following these simple steps:
1. Determine your caloric needs – calculate how many calories you need to consume each day to maintain your current weight. You can use an online calculator or consult a registered dietitian for this.
2. Choose healthy, nutrient-dense foods – include foods that are high in protein, fiber, and healthy fats in your meal plan. This will help you feel fuller longer and avoid cravings.
3. Plan your meals in advance – try planning a week’s worth of meals ahead of time, based on your caloric needs and healthy food choices.
4. Prepare meals in advance – take one day a week to cook and prepare your meals for the week ahead. This will save you time during the week and make it easier to stick to your plan.
5. Stick to your plan – once you have your meals planned and prepared, stick to it! Avoid temptation by avoiding unhealthy foods and making healthy choices.
